How to Invest in Luxury Real Estate in Bologna

Investing in luxury real estate in Bologna can be a rewarding venture, given the city’s rich history, vibrant culture, and growing economy. If you're considering dipping your toes into this market, the following steps will guide you through the process of successfully investing in high-end properties.

1. Understand the Bologna Real Estate Market

Before making any investments, it's crucial to familiarize yourself with the Bologna real estate landscape. Bologna is a city that boasts a mix of historical architecture and modern amenities. Key neighborhoods to consider include the historic center, which attracts both locals and tourists, and more upscale areas like Saragozza and Santo Stefano.

2. Define Your Investment Criteria

Identify your investment goals. Are you looking for rental income, capital appreciation, or a personal vacation home? Defining your criteria helps narrow down property options. For luxury real estate, focus on properties with unique features, excellent locations, and high-quality finishes.

3. Partner with a Reputable Real Estate Agent

An experienced real estate agent specializing in luxury properties can provide invaluable insights. They understand the market trends, pricing, and legalities involved in buying real estate in Bologna. Look for an agent with a solid track record in the luxury sector and positive client testimonials.

4. Conduct Thorough Research

Research is key to making informed investment decisions. Look into recent sales in your targeted neighborhoods to gauge property values. Assess factors that may influence future growth, such as infrastructure developments, educational institutions, and commercial projects.

5. Visit Properties in Person

Photos and virtual tours can be helpful, but nothing beats visiting the property in person. Pay attention to the neighborhood and amenities available nearby, such as shops, restaurants, and parks. Ensure the property meets your standards and aligns with your investment goals.

6. Analyze Potential Returns

Calculate potential rental income if you plan to lease the property. Consider costs such as property taxes, maintenance fees, and management expenses. Compare these with local rental prices for similar properties to ensure a favorable return on investment.

7. Understand Legal Requirements

Italy has specific regulations regarding real estate transactions, especially for foreign investors. It’s essential to work with a legal expert who understands Italian real estate law. They can assist with due diligence, contracts, and ensure that all legalities are in order.

8. Secure Financing

If you require financing for your investment, research various mortgage options available to foreign investors in Italy. Compare interest rates, terms, and conditions from different banks to find the best fit for your financial situation.

9. Make an Offer and Negotiate

Once you find a property that meets your criteria, make an offer. Be prepared to negotiate to reach a mutually agreeable price. Your real estate agent can provide guidance on the market value and assist in crafting a competitive offer.

10. Close the Deal

After agreeing on a price, you'll need to finalize the sale. This involves signing various legal documents and transferring funds. Ensure you have a qualified notary who can oversee the transaction, as their presence is mandatory for property transfers in Italy.

11. Manage Your Property Effectively

If you intend to rent out your luxury property, hire a property management company with experience in the luxury market. They can handle tenant interactions, maintenance issues, and ensure your investment remains in excellent condition.

12. Monitor the Market

After your investment is secured, keep an eye on market trends. Understanding the fluctuations in luxury real estate can help you make informed decisions about future investments or when to sell your property for optimal profit.

Investing in luxury real estate in Bologna offers significant potential. By following these steps and staying informed, you can navigate the complexities of this market and make a successful investment.
